The Arts et Métiers Institute Arts et Métiers Chalon-sur-Saône, in partnership withLe Grand Chalon,Usinerie Partners, UIMM,IUT Chalon-sur-Saône, andCnam BFC, organized the 10th edition of the Chal'EngeAM challenge.
For 10 years now, this competition has served as a professional springboard for our students in Master of Science , and they are joined by students in the AI & Big Data engineering degree program offered by CNAM BFC. The competition is also introducing a new category of projects. In addition to virtual and augmented reality demos, projects focused on Artificial Intelligence are now being accepted.
